Chester 'emerges' to lead SA

Thu, 15 May 2008 16:04

World Cup-winning Springbok Chester Williams has been named as the new coach of the Emerging SA team to defend their International Rugby Board (IRB) Nations Cup title in Romania in June.

Williams succeeds new Springbok coach Peter de Villiers who led the team to the title in 2007, according to a SA Rugby media release.

Boland coach Deon Davids will act as assistant coach to Williams in a seven-man management team.

The team again faces 2007 Rugby World Cup finalists Georgia (June 11) and Romania (June 20) as well as Italy A (June 15).

Williams is perfectly placed to understand the challenges the Emerging SA team will face as he is currently coaching in Romania as director of rugby for Dinamo Bucharest.

"The national team has been together here for two years and they always qualify for the World Cup," said Williams. "It will be quite tough to come here and expect to beat them - we will have to work hard to achieve a result."

Williams has spent three months with Dinamo, leading them to the league title and into Sunday's national cup final after which he will return to South Africa. "It's great to know that I can get back into the system with SA Rugby," he said. "I have been following the Vodacom Super 14 very closely through television and I'm sure we can put out a very strong team."

The squad will be named shortly before assembling in Cape Town on May 26 for a training camp before departure on June 7.

The IRB Nations Cup was introduced to the global Rugby calendar in 2006 in order to provide an expanded competition pathway for Tier 1 A sides, while providing Tier 2 and 3 Test teams with the opportunity to compete in a high intensity international competition against high level opposition.

The inaugural competition was won by Argentina A in Portugal. Emerging SA beat Argentina A in Romania last year to claim the title on their first appearance.

Management team:

Head Coach: Chester Williams
Assistant Coach: Deon Davids (Boland)
Team Manager: Pieter Visser (Golden Lions)
Doctor: Dr Craig Thompson (Vodacom Western Province)
Physiotherapist: Vivian Verwant (Vodacom Free State)
Conditioner: Robbie Brazelle (Vodacom Free State)
Baggage Master: JJ Fredericks (SA Rugby)
